Traveling Out of Town - Finding the Best Rental Rates

Are you traveling out of town and need to find a rental car? There are many rental agencies to choose from and finding the best deal on the car model you want can be a bit tricky. Here are some tips to finding the rental car you want at the best price.

The internet makes finding a rental car easy. There are a few different ways to check on rates and you should explore all options to find the best deal. The first place to check is the online agencies such as Travelocity and Orbitz that will price and model compare for you. Simply specify which dates you need a rental and the available models and rates from various car rental agencies is displayed. You can also book your hotel and plane tickets at the same time so it's one stop shopping. Keep in mind that these types of websites usually charge a nominal fee for their service but it can be worth it for the sake of convenience.

The next place to check online is the individual rental car companies' websites. There are special rates and deals that some companies only make available to customers who book directly through their website. It's also a good idea to scan their specials and look for coupons. You can join their loyalty program or sign up for their email newsletters so you can be alerted when there is a special. Loyalty programs will give you access to specials and other perks such as fast car pickup and drop off.

It is also a good idea to perform an online search for car rental coupons. These coupons are virtual coupons; nothing tangible is required. There will be a coupon or rate code needed when you book your reservation. These coupons have many restrictions so it's important to read the fine print to see if your rental qualifies. All car rental agencies offer discounts such as senior, corporate and auto club discounts. You'll need a special code when booking the reservation. If you don't know the correct code then you can call the agency directly. Keep in mind that discounts are not usually valid in conjunction with special rates. You need to show proof (such as a membership card) when you pick up your car.

If you're on a tight budget then consider renting a lower class model. Almost all rental cars come with options such as air conditioning and CD players. Some car companies will try to entice you with an upgrade for just a few dollars more a day but keep in mind that a larger car will have a higher fuel cost. So if you can, rent an economy or compact size car.
